Four nights of live music at The Snug

Tonight, Thursday March 5, local band Snakebite play The Snug. This pop/rock cover band will be playing all the favourites spanning several decades.

On Friday March 6 The Snug Bar welcomes Macey South back to the stage. This talented three piece band are known for their energetic performance. Their unique mix of traditional music and rock and roll is not to be missed. You can also expect a guest appearance from Johnny Murray with his much celebrated Seamus Moore cover.

Saturday night sees Reigning Day take over. Chason and Declan from Castlerea are no strangers to The Snug Bar and have gained a reputation for creating a great lively pub atmosphere which will have everyone joining in with the craic. DJ Jamie will also be setting the mood in the beer garden.

This Sunday The Snug Bar hosts the best of Tullamore’s musical talent. Popular solo artist Gavin G graces the stage at 7pm and is always applauded by the crowd for his high level performance. Gavin is followed by JigJam at 9pm. JigJam’s debut album Oh Boy was launched recently and has been getting great reviews nationally. With exhilarating melodies on the five string banjo combined with the driving rhythm of guitar and double bass, they produce a fantastic blend of modern, Irish, and folk music with a special bluegrass twist. This Tullamore band really aims to please and creates brilliant lively atmosphere not to be missed. A great night is guaranteed.
